    An existing client of mine recently purchased this Viper AC1. The car was already in really good shape when it was delivered, but lacked that "pop" that we would all want from a vehicle of this caliber. After 9 hours the Viper is worthy of its name, and Megiuars is to blame for another beautiful car that we all wish we had.

    Did I ever mention that I like my job?

    Wash w/ Shampoo Plus
    Clay with Mild detailing clay (Blue for the noobs)
    2x #21
    3x #7 Show Car Glaze
    All Season Dressing on the tires
    Silicon Free Dressing in the wheel wells and on black engine pieces

    Did you tape off any areas before detailing?

    Did you have to go back and clean trim or creases of dried product?

    I am getting ready to use the DA for the first time on my Bimmer and Benz and would like to know.

      First answer, we always tape off any trim or cracks where we dont want wax/polish/glaze. The Viper wasnt all that bad as its a very large w/ many curves and not very much trim (just around the windows and lights.

      Second answer, there was slight dust in some of ther cracks. The biggest problem always seems to be the 'dusting' thats created when applying product. Keep your pads clean, dont over use product, and take your time on the prep work and you should do just fine.
